What a blast! Certainly, the day and drive are long, but there is so much scenery along the way to these beautiful spots. While I went in early April, Borjomi was a bit reserved as it seems most popular in later months. Rabath was beautiful! The castle and scenery all around were great. Vardzia was like nothing I’ve seen in Europe before. It was so cool to explore through the tunnels and climb all the steps and into the rooms of the monastery.
